Abstract(in English) | A human can pay selective attention to music or speech from various sounds. It has been reported that in a speech domain, selective attention enhances the correlation between the envelope of the speech and the EEG and also affects the spatial modulation of the alpha band. However, it is unclear how selective attention affects entrainment and spatial modulation with multiple music presentations. In this article, we hypothesized that the entrainment to the attended music is stronger than the unattended music and that spatial modulation occurs in conjunction with attention under multiple music presentations. To investigate our hypothesis, we analyzed EEG during the simultaneous presentation of two melodies. The results showed that the cross-correlation function between the EEG and the envelope of the unattended melody had a larger peak than that of the attended melody, contrary to the findings for speech. In addition, attended melodies were identified using machine learning with features extracted from alpha-band using the common spatial pattern method reflecting spatial modulation as input. As a result, we achieved an accuracy of 100% for eleven of fifteen participants. These results suggest that selective attention to music suppresses the entrainment to the melody and that spatial modulation of the alpha band occurs in conjunction with attention. |
